Local soul outfit The Bamboos will return this November, with a brand new album and a handful of national shows to follow.

It hasn't been that long since the band's breakout hit record Medicine Man was released, but we'll be treated to new tunes from Lance Ferguson and regular collaborators Kylie Auldist and Ella Thompson, who will feature on all eleven songs off Fever In The Road, real soon. The LP will be released through Ferguson's own label Pacific Theatre via Inertia on Friday 8 November. Its first single Avenger is available through iTunes now.
